On 18-03-2015, Lok Sabha passed the Repealing and Amending Bill, 2014. The objective of the Bill is to repeal the enactments which have ceased to be in force or have become obsolete or the retention whereof as separate Acts is unnecessary OR correct/ amend the formal defects detected in the enactments.

The Bill wholly repeals the following 36 enactments:

      The Bill amends the following enactments:

 

  1. Prohibition of Employment as Manual Scavengers and their Rehabilitation Act, 2013
    • In the proviso to Section 1(3) of the said Act, for the words “the notification”, the words “the said notification” shall be substituted.
  1. Whistle Blowers Protection Act, 2011
    • In the Section 1(1); of the said Act, for the figures “2011”, the figures “2014” shall be substituted, and
    • in the Enacting Formula, for the words “Sixty-second Year”, the words “Sixty-fifth Year” shall be substituted.
